Minimum 31 day stay required. Hale Ka Nani, which means “beautiful house” in Hawaiian, is situated on 3.3 acres in the private, gated community of Kohala Ranch on the beautiful Kohala "Gold" coast. Kohala Ranch is a large 4,000 acre secure/gated “working” ranch, approximately 45 miles north of Kailua-Kona and 75 miles from Hilo.It is the perfect place for enjoying Hawaii Island without the crowds and tourist traffic of the resorts and hotel areas. This spacious 700 square foot guest suite has a kitchen, living/dining room, one bedroom with queen bed, and spacious bathroom with large shower, separate toilet, and twin vessel sinks. The home can accommodate two tofour people with the pull out queen-sized wall bed in the living room. Hale Ka Nani is an attached guest suite and has its own private entrance and parking area. This newly-built guest suite was completed in March 2017. Tastefully decorated, and completely self-sufficient, it is a wonderful place for you to bask in the loveliness of Hawaii Island and feel what it is like to actually live on the island.
The spacious 700 square foot lanai has an outdoor eating table for four, gas grill, and comfortable lounge furniture for you to enjoy a mai tai while you watch the sun set in the center of your 180 degree ocean view. Your views include open ranch land, coastline, the islands of Maui,Koolawe, Molokini, and Lanai, and three volcanoes; Hualalai, Mauna Loa, and the oftensnowcapped Mauna Kea. The famous Kohala Coastline sunsets are an artist’s dream, painting theskies with pink, red, orange, yellow, and blue. On clear evenings you might see the famous "Green Flash" as the sun dips below the horizon or one of the numerous rainbows that arch over the ranch. At night, you can sit out on the lanai and star watch because the Big Island limits “light pollution” for star viewing by the telescopes on top of Mauna Kea.
This one-bedroom unit is one of the best deals onthe Big Island. This suite does not have air conditioning, but is equipped with ceiling fans since air conditioning is not needed at this perfect elevation of approximately 1600 feet, making it 7-10 degrees cooler than on the coast. This area is dry and sunny with an average of 357 sunny days and an average of 7 inches of rain per year. Kawaihae Harbor, 15 minutes away, offers multiple dining opportunities including a local Tiki bar, perfect for happy hour or a fresh seafood dinner. There is a fresh fish market, a burger/taco restaurant, and an ice cream shop featuring Hawaii Shaved Ice. You can reserve and depart on adive, snorkel, sport fishing or whale watch adventure from the harbor. The small, historic sugar plantation towns of Hawi and Kapa'au are approximately 20-35 minutesdrive north of us. These are artist communities with great shops and quaint eateries. Look for the photography of Julie Eliason, one of the Hale Ka Nani owners, inthe galleries.
At the north endof the highway is the famous Pololu Valley, which you can hike down to enjoy spectacularcoastline views and a rugged beach. Waimea town is a short 25 minute drive where you canenjoy local farmers markets, shopping, a micro brewhaus, and several restaurants.
